Output 75f8c3e08b680fc1e39fe906656c3b1689bcf6c0366ff7b779945663e9ccfec3:5

value
540546472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ac8ca5fba35ef30e44c9c38145a912a49f8b8bff OP_EQUAL
address
3HRNdxZPfbrU1MWA7BzqRRxHy1ZJcDULv7
transaction
75f8c3e08b680fc1e39fe906656c3b1689bcf6c0366ff7b779945663e9ccfec3
spent
true